Frequently asked questions (FAQ)

What can I see from the glass-bottom boat? You’ll observe vibrant coral formations, colorful fish, sea turtles, and other fascinating marine creatures without getting wet.
Is the glass-bottom boat suitable for all ages? Yes! It’s a great option for guests of all ages, especially those who prefer to stay dry while enjoying the marine environment.
How long does the glass-bottom boat tour last? The excursion typically lasts around 45 minutes to an hour, depending on the itinerary and marine conditions.
Is the tour guided? Yes, a naturalist guide will be on board to explain the marine life and ecosystem visible through the glass panels.
